Hi, schau mal:
A: Wenn ein falsches Image geflasht wurde, am besten NICHT REBOOTEN! Solange die Box noch im Rescue-Loader läuft, kann man mit E weiter machen und kann sich den ganzen Spaß mit CFE BIOS sparen
B: Wenn die Box schon nicht mehr bootet und auch nicht in den Rescue-Loader kommt, muss man ins CFE BIOS kommen, um die Box wieder in den Rescue-Loader booten zu können. Das geht in drei Schritten
B - 1: Serielle Verbindung zur Box aufbauen
B - 2: Box in Rescue-Loader booten (bzw. es versuchen und warten bis "Loading Setup..." erscheint)
B - 3: In der seriellen Konsole sollte "CFE> " erscheinen.
C: Wenn man die Box im CFE BIOS hat, kann man die Box per TFTP in den Rescue-Loader booten:
C - 1: Auf dem PC den richtigen, aktuellen Rescue-Loader in ein Verzeichnis laden und dieses Verzeichnis in PumpKIN unter Options als "TFTP filesystem root" festlegen.
C - 2: Im CFE folgendes eingeben: boot -tftp -elf PC-IP:vmlinuz-rescue--3.4-RICHTIGEVERSIONUNDSOWEITER.bin
C - 3: Bei PumpKIN kommt bei mir noch eine Abfrage, ob man Zugriff auf die Datei geben will. Hier "Grant Access" anklicken.
D: Jetzt sollte die Box den Rescue-Loader laden und dann booten. Im Display sollte dann auch eine IP erscheinen. Diese im Webbrowser ansurfen und normal flashen
E: Bevor man rebootet, sollte man den Rescue-Loader auch noch flashen. Das passiert bei den vorherigen Schritten nicht. Die Befehle dafür lauten (URL und Dateiname natürlich passend ersetzen):
Quellcode
- cd /tmp
- wget
BOX/vmlinuz-rescue--3.4-RICHTIGEVERSIONUNDSOWEITER.bin
- flash-rescue /tmp/vmlinuz-rescue--3.4-RICHTIGEVERSIONUNDSOWEITER.bin